Dopamine Receptors
Proteins located on the surface of neurons in the brain that bind to dopamine, a neurotransmitter involved in reward, motivation, and many aspects of behavior.
Hallucinations
Perceptions in the absence of external stimuli, such as seeing, hearing, or feeling something that isn't there.
Schizophrenia
A psychiatric disorder characterized by delusions, hallucinations, disorganized speech, and impaired cognitive functionality.
Dutch Famine
A period of severe starvation that took place in the Netherlands during World War II, leading to significant health and developmental problems for those affected.
